Location:
St. Albans, London Aldgate, Manchester or Croydon Contract Type: 12-month contract Summary Our client is seeking a Principal Fire Protection Engineer specialising in Fire Fighting Systems design to join their established fire safety consultancy. This consultancy-based role requires experience in designing, calculating, and proposing fire safety solutions for a variety of projects, ranging from small to large scale. You will act as a key technical expert and point of contact for clients, delivering design packages across various RIBA stages, including drawings, technical specifications, reports, and hydraulic calculations.
The role involves preparing fire suppression system solutions for diverse building and industrial applications, performing system calculations, leading remote project delivery teams, and managing projects from inception to completion. You will also conduct technical reviews, assist in resolving design issues, and liaise effectively with clients, contractors, and regulatory authorities. This position is ideal for an established consultant seeking career progression or a knowledgeable professional aiming to join a respected fire safety consultancy.
Skills Extensive experience in fire fighting systems design within a consultancy environment Strong knowledge of British and International design standards and Building Regulations Expertise in Fire Suppression Systems including Automatic Sprinkler Systems (Wet, Dry, Pre-action, Foam), Water Mist Systems, Gaseous Suppression Systems, Wet and Dry Riser Systems, Fire Hydrant and Hose Reel Systems, Hypoxic (Oxygen Reduction) Systems Ability to prepare design packages for various RIBA stages (1-7) including drawings, specifications, reports, and hydraulic calculations Proficient in performing hydraulic and system calculations (sprinkler water supplies, gas suppression agent quantities) Experience in project management and leading remote project delivery teams Strong client-facing and communication skills Ability to conduct site surveys, inspections, and technical problem resolution Competent in preparing fee proposals and conducting technical reviews Intermediate-level written and oral communication skills with strong quantitative and analytical abilities Software/Tools Microsoft Word and Excel CAD software (AutoCAD, Revit) Hydraulic calculation software for fire suppression systems Certifications & Standards Relevant degree or professional qualification (BEng, MEng, PhD) Chartered Engineer (CEng) or Incorporated Engineer (IEng) status or working towards it Clear work history demonstrating continuous professional development Knowledge of relevant British and International fire safety standards and building regulations Please send CVs to:
